Importance of Trip Registration at the Sweden Embassy

Registering your trip with the Sweden embassy is crucial for ensuring safety, effective communication, and access to support during emergencies. In case of natural disasters such as earthquakes or floods, having your travel information on file enables the embassy to provide timely updates and assistance. For travelers caught in political unrest, the embassy can expedite evacuation procedures and keep you informed about safe zones. Additionally, in medical emergencies where swift assistance is needed, registration allows the embassy to respond quickly and coordinate help, which can be vital for ensuring your well-being. By keeping the embassy informed of your travel plans, you enhance your safety and ensure that you can access vital support in unexpected situations.

Sweden Embassy FAQs

  • Can the Sweden embassy assist in legal issues abroad? Yes, the Sweden embassy can provide general guidance on legal matters and may recommend local legal counsel.

  • What should I do if I lose my Sweden passport in Botswana? If you lose your passport, report the loss to the local authorities immediately, and then contact the Sweden embassy for assistance with a replacement passport and any other necessary documentation.

  • Do I need to make an appointment to visit the Sweden embassy? Yes, it is advisable to make an appointment for certain services to ensure that you receive timely assistance.

  • What services does the Sweden embassy offer for Swedes living in Botswana? The Sweden embassy provides various services, including notarial services, guidance on residency, and updates on voting rights.

Summarized Diplomatic Presence

Sweden maintains a diplomatic presence in Botswana through its embassy located in Gaborone. The embassy plays a fundamental role in fostering international relations between Sweden and Botswana. Its primary functions include providing consular services to Swedish nationals, facilitating bilateral trade, and engaging in cultural exchange initiatives. By enhancing diplomatic ties, the embassy promotes mutual understanding and collaboration on various issues, strengthening the overall relationship between the two nations. The presence of the embassy is vital for supporting Swedes living in or visiting Botswana and fostering cooperative efforts in areas such as human rights, trade, and sustainable development.
